The property

An excellent opportunity has arisen to purchase this well presented second floor flat, forming part of a traditional tenement enjoying a fantastic location in the popular district of Tollcross, with convenient access to the city centre and a host of local amenities. The generously proportioned accommodation is bound to appeal to the buy to let investor or professional couple and early viewing is highly recommended. In brief the property comprises; secure entry system, welcoming entrance hallway, spacious and bright lounge/bedroom 3, modern fitted kitchen/dining/living area, two good sized double bedrooms, modern bathroom with three-piece suite and shower over bath, and separate shower room with shower enclosure. Further benefits include gas central heating. There is a communal garden to the rear together with metered/permit parking available to the front and in the surrounding area.

Council Tax Band D
Total Floor Area 78 m2
Energy rating C
